Seeing the check engine light pop up is never fun. When a scanner shows a P1178 vehicle code symptoms list, it usually points to a fuel mixture problem, often specifically a lean condition off-idle. Knowing what to expect helps you decide if the car is safe to drive to the shop or if it needs a tow. Ignoring these signs can lead to worse engine damage or failed emissions tests.

What does the P1178 code indicate?

This trouble code typically means the engine control module detects a fuel mixture that is too lean when you are not idling. While the exact definition varies by manufacturer, it often appears in BMW models regarding the fuel mixture control. If you are looking at diagnostic signs for your specific make, you will see it relates to how air and fuel mix during acceleration.

What will my car feel like?

Drivers usually notice performance issues before they see the light. Common error symptoms include a rough idle when stopped at lights. You might feel hesitation when pressing the gas pedal. Some vehicles stall unexpectedly in traffic. Fuel economy often drops because the computer tries to compensate for the lean condition by adding more fuel later.

  • Check engine light is on
  • Rough or unstable idle
  • Poor acceleration response
  • Engine stalling
  • Increased fuel consumption

Why does this code appear?

Understanding the meaning of code definitions helps narrow down the cause. A vacuum leak is a common culprit. Air enters the engine where it should not, skewing the mixture. Faulty oxygen sensors can also send wrong data to the computer. Sometimes, a dirty mass airflow sensor causes the issue. It is rarely just one thing, so testing is required.

Is it safe to drive with this code?

It depends on the severity. If the car stalls frequently, do not drive it. A lean condition can cause the engine to run hot, potentially damaging valves or pistons over time. If the car runs smoothly but the light is on, you might make it to a repair shop. When keeping records of your car issues, make sure your notes are legible. If you print diagnostic logs, choose a clear font name so the mechanic can read your history without squinting.

What should I do next?

Start with a visual inspection. Look for cracked vacuum hoses around the intake manifold. Check the gas cap to ensure it is tight. If you have an OBD2 scanner, clear the code and see if it returns immediately. If the problem persists, professional help is best.

  • Inspect vacuum lines for cracks
  • Check the mass airflow sensor
  • Test oxygen sensor readings
  • Clear the code and test drive
  • Visit a mechanic if stalling occurs